The two typical weapons a Roman soldier would have been armed with were, more often than not, the gladius and the pilum. The type of pilum, or javelin, could vary from soldier to soldier, though, and some favored a typical Square Pilum like this one. A historical pilum consisted of a wooden pole or shaft affixed to an iron shank, and this Roman javelin is no different, at least in terms of shape. The weapon consists of a hardwood shaft mounted with a pointed butt-spike as well as a square-shaped socket designed for mounting a lethal-looking shank. Affixed into the javelins haft at the socket is a long carbon steel spike that ends with a barbed, pyramidal tip that was designed to promote penetration, while also disabling whatever it lodged itself in. This pilum is modeled after the typical Roman pilum, thus striking a middle ground between range, weight, and penetrative power. Authentic in look and feel, this Square Pilum would look great carried in the hands of a Roman re-enactor fully dressed in Roman armor, and it would look just as great carefully displayed in a collectors decor of antique Roman arms and armor.

This Roman Spear is constructed like a pilum, although its weight and balance are completely different. Like a pilum (or javelin), this spear is constructed using a hardwood shaft that features a pointed butt-spike. And like a weighted pilum, just above the grip, this spear features a heavy ball that increases the weight and force of the spears thrust. Unlike a pilum, though, this spear features a permanently affixed narrow metal shaft that extends out and then swiftly widens to form a small spear-blade, before tapering to a sharp, piercing point.
